Objective To study the clinical features and method of diagnosis and treatment in appendiceal carcinoid,in order to increase the rate of preoperative diagnosis,and find the way of rational therapy to improve the prognosis.Methods The clinical data of 5 cases with the appendiceal carcinoid from Nov 2001 to Feb 2009 were retrospectively analyzed.Result The diagnosis was established pathologically after operation in all 5 patients. The tumor was located at the tip in 3 patients,at the middle in 1 and at the base in 1. The diameter of tumor was less than lcm in 1 patient,between 1 and 2cm in 2 and larger than 2cm in 2.Tumor invasion was confined to submucosa in 1 patient,to muscle and serosa layer in 3 patients and beside the serosa in 1 patient.Two patients had partial nodular transfer.Appendectomy was performed in 1 case,right hemicolectomy in 3 cases and ileocecal junction resection in 1 case.The majority of carcinoid of appendix was typical carcinoid histologically except one goblet cell carcinoid.All these 5 patients received follow-up from 1 to 7 years.No tumor recurrence and metastasis occurred.Conclusion Appendiceal carcinoid is rare and difficult to be diagnosed preoperatively. The operation is the major method of treatment and the style of operation depend on the size,location and invasive depth of the tumor.The effect of chemotherapy and other adjunctive therapy need to be investigated futher.
